Output 51c0fd2acb151797635ff2c91b2feaf8c97ced46e9a337f6f5bf62006748389a:1

value
105549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d52d6d7ef2a66357d4baf746dea858923bc2122 OP_EQUAL
address
3G2sFS1Auf1dkQFujTXccvWccA5wdc8pxA
transaction
51c0fd2acb151797635ff2c91b2feaf8c97ced46e9a337f6f5bf62006748389a
spent
true